"Every restaurant was packed in The Distillery District so we opted for this simple and affordable eatery that offers all the Italian essentials.\n\nThe weather was mild so we sat on the rustic terrace with wooden benches. We were given our menus right away, and the bread came soon after. Everything smelled delicious which put us in a good mood.\n\nMy fianc\u00E9 ordered COMMENDATORE pasta which costed $21 and had sausage, smoked provolone,\nspinach, leeks, pistachios, and cream. I took (stole) a bite of it, it was creamy and comforting like being wrapped in freshly laundered blankets.\n\nWith that said, I enjoyed my own pasta immensely better. The actual name of the dish escapes me but it essentially had fusilli with squid and sausage in a spicy tomato sauce. Did it hit the spot? Totally! The level of spiciness was perfect for me and I loved how chewy the squids were. \n\nWhy only 3 stars then? Well it was just another run of the mill Italian restaurant that lacked creativity and refinement but did everything that they are supposed to."^^ . "0"^^ . . "3"^^ . "1"^^ . .
